    Abstract:

    In order to further develop the resources of Podocarpus Nagi, the technology of ultrasonic assisted soxhlet extraction for the extraction of Podocarpus nagi was optimized by single factor and response surface tests. The physicochemical properties and fatty acid composition were analyzed. The results showed that the optimum extraction conditions were as follows: the extraction temperature 75 ℃, the solid-liquid ratio 140 (g/mL), the extraction time 150 min and extraction solvent n-hexane. Under this condition, the yield of bamboo nut oil was 29.32%. The analysis via GC-MS method showed that nine kinds of fatty acids were detected in the bamboo nut oil, including 95.81% unsaturated fatty acids and 76.27% polyunsaturated fatty acids, which were significantly higher than monounsaturated fatty acids (19.54% ),of which linoleic acid content was the highest and was rich in oleic acid, eicosadienoic acid and eicosatrienoic acid.
